Output 68bda71dc6de3b4e2804c8cfaf40c86e34599e8a47b71055c02a607660c4ce0e:0

value
500000
script pubkey
OP_0 OP_PUSHBYTES_20 538d5ea8a6905656a9f75ffde5f935137b3810f2
address
bc1q2wx4a29xjpt9d20htl77t7f4zdansy8jahpjhf
transaction
68bda71dc6de3b4e2804c8cfaf40c86e34599e8a47b71055c02a607660c4ce0e
confirmations
145134
spent
true